Can i eat dry toast for diarrhea?

Can i eat dry toast for diarrhea? diet: Just having bananas, rice, applesauce, and dry toast is no longer the diet of choice for diarrhea. These foods are still okay to eat, though. Exercise moderately until the diarrhea is gone.

Is toast better than bread for diarrhea? DIARRHOEA: Toasted bread is a great method to help people who are suffering from diarrhoea. Toasted bread adds bulk to your stool and treats diarrhoea. Toast is also a part of the biggest anti-diarrhoea diet, BRAT which stands for bananas, rice, apple sauce and toast.

Will dry toast settle my stomach? Foods high in starch — such as saltines, bread, and toast — help absorb gastric acid and settle a queasy stomach. “The bland nature of a cracker helps to satisfy hunger (excessive hunger can exasperate nausea) without the strong smells or tastes that may increase nausea,” says Palinski-Wade.

What can you have on toast when you have diarrhea? Bland “BRAT” foods — bananas, rice, applesauce, and toast — were once recommended to treat diarrhea. But BRAT foods don’t have enough of other nutrients you need, like protein and fat.

Can i soak french toast overnight?

Overnight French toast is very similar in flavor to a classic stovetop French toast, but instead of individually soaking the bread slices in the egg/milk mixture, then frying them on the stove, you layer the bread into a casserole dish, pour the egg/milk mixture over the top and refrigerate it overnight.

How thick can a envelope be?

Q. How large can an envelope be and still be eligible for First-Class Mail letter rates? A. The maximum size is 11-1/2 inches x 6-1/8 inches x 1/4 inch thick.

What is considered a large envelope?

A Large Envelope is a rectangular mailpiece no thicker than 3/4 inch. They are commonly referred to as “Flats.” Flats must be: Have four square corners (or finished corners not exceeding a radius of 0.125 (1/8) inch.

What size is a standard letter size envelope?

Rectangular. At least 3-1/2 inches high x 5 inches long x 0.007 inch thick. No more than 6-1/8 inches high x 11-1/2 inches long x 1/4 inch thick.
